数据湖解决了什么问题
-
数据湖解决了数据存储的灵活性、数据分析的多样性、实时数据处理的能力、数据共享的便利性、以及数据治理的有效性问题。 在当今数据驱动的时代,传统的数据仓库往往无法满足日益增长的多样化数据需求,数据湖应运而生。数据湖的灵活性体现在它能够处理各种类型的数据,包括结构化、半结构化和非结构化数据,使得企业能够以更低的成本存储和分析大量数据。通过数据湖,组织可以在不牺牲数据质量和安全性的前提下,快速获取和分析数据,为决策提供更为准确和及时的支持。
一、数据存储的灵活性
数据湖的核心优势之一是其出色的存储灵活性。与传统数据仓库相比,数据湖不需要预先定义数据模式,允许用户以原始格式存储数据。这种灵活性使企业能够快速适应不断变化的数据需求,尤其是在面对新的数据源时。企业可以在数据湖中存储各种数据类型,包括文本、图像、视频及传感器数据等,这为后续的数据分析和挖掘提供了丰富的资源。
数据湖的这种灵活性不仅提升了数据存储的效率,也降低了数据集成的复杂性。企业在将数据上传至数据湖时,不必花费大量时间进行数据清洗和转换。这种“存储即服务”的理念使得数据湖成为了企业应对大数据挑战的理想解决方案。随着数据量的持续增长,企业能够通过数据湖更好地管理和利用这些数据,从而在竞争中获得优势。
二、数据分析的多样性
数据湖为多样化的数据分析提供了支持。因为数据湖能够容纳各类数据,企业可以利用多种分析工具和技术,对数据进行深度挖掘与洞察。这种多样性不仅体现在分析工具的选择上,还包括分析方法的多样化。例如,企业可以利用机器学习、人工智能等先进技术对数据进行预测分析和模式识别,发现潜在的商业机会。
此外,数据湖支持自助式分析,允许不同部门的用户根据自身的需求进行数据探索。这样的灵活性使得业务分析师和数据科学家能够更快地获取所需的数据,进行更为精准的分析。这种去中心化的分析方式有助于打破信息孤岛,提高决策的效率和准确性。借助数据湖,企业能够更全面地理解市场趋势、客户行为及运营效率,从而制定更为科学的战略。
三、实时数据处理的能力
在当今快速变化的商业环境中,实时数据处理能力显得尤为重要。数据湖能够支持流式数据处理,实时分析来自各种传感器、社交媒体和交易系统的数据。这种能力使得企业能够在数据生成的同时进行分析,及时响应市场变化和客户需求,从而保持竞争优势。
实时数据处理的优势在于能够提供即时洞察,帮助企业做出快速决策。例如,零售企业可以实时监控销售数据和库存情况,及时调整促销策略和库存管理。这种灵活性和及时性使得企业能够更好地应对突发事件和市场波动,从而优化运营效率和客户体验。通过数据湖的实时处理能力,企业可以实现更高效的业务运作和更优质的客户服务。
四、数据共享的便利性
数据湖促进了数据的共享与协作,使得不同部门和团队能够更轻松地访问和利用数据。这种便利性不仅提升了数据的可用性,也增强了组织内部的协作效率。通过数据湖,企业能够打破信息壁垒,使得不同的业务单位能够共享数据资源,形成协同效应。
此外,数据湖的开放性和灵活性使得外部合作伙伴也能够访问必要的数据。这种数据共享的模式为企业与合作伙伴之间建立更紧密的联系提供了可能性。通过与外部机构共享数据,企业能够获取更多的市场洞察和行业信息,从而更好地进行战略规划与决策。这种共享机制不仅提升了企业的创新能力,也推动了整个生态系统的良性发展。
五、数据治理的有效性
尽管数据湖在灵活性和多样性上具有显著优势,但数据治理依然是企业关注的重要问题。数据湖的有效治理能够确保数据的质量、安全性和合规性。企业需要建立一套完善的数据治理框架,对数据的获取、存储和使用进行全面管理。这种框架应该包括数据分类、数据标准化、数据访问控制等多方面的内容,以确保数据的可靠性和安全性。
通过有效的数据治理,企业能够提高数据的可追溯性和透明度。这种透明度有助于企业满足合规要求,降低数据泄露和滥用的风险。此外,数据治理还能够促进数据的有效利用,使得企业能够在合规的前提下,充分挖掘数据的价值。通过不断完善数据治理机制,企业能够在快速变化的市场环境中,保持对数据的有效管理和利用,确保业务的持续增长。
1年前 -
数据湖解决了数据存储与管理的灵活性问题、数据整合与分析的效率问题、以及大规模数据处理的成本问题。 数据湖为企业提供了一种高效的方式来集中存储不同格式和来源的数据,支持多种类型的分析和挖掘。这种灵活性使得企业能够快速响应市场变化,适应不断增长的数据需求。数据湖不仅可以存储结构化数据,还能处理半结构化和非结构化数据,这样的多样性使得数据科学家和分析师能够更好地发掘潜在的商业价值。通过数据湖,企业可以减少数据孤岛现象,打破部门之间的数据壁垒,实现全面的数据分析与决策支持。
一、数据湖的定义与基本概念
数据湖是一种用于存储海量数据的架构,通常是以原始格式保存数据。这种架构允许存储多种类型的数据,包括结构化数据(如数据库表)、半结构化数据(如JSON、XML文件)以及非结构化数据(如文档、图像和视频)。与传统的数据仓库相比,数据湖的主要特点在于其更高的灵活性和扩展性。企业可以轻松地将新数据加入湖中,而无需进行复杂的数据转换和清理。此外,数据湖通常基于分布式存储技术,使其能够处理大规模数据集,支持企业在大数据时代的需求。
二、数据湖解决的数据存储与管理的灵活性问题
数据湖的灵活性体现在其能够适应各种数据类型和格式。传统的数据库往往需要在存储之前对数据进行严格的模式定义,这意味着对于新数据类型的支持非常有限。而数据湖允许企业存储原始数据,数据可以在后期根据需要进行处理和分析。这种能力使得企业能够快速采集和存储来自不同来源的数据,比如社交媒体、传感器数据、日志文件等。企业可根据实际需要,对数据进行分类和整理,而不是在数据采集阶段就必须做出限制性决策。
数据湖的另一个重要优势是其支持实时数据流的能力。随着物联网和实时分析需求的增长,企业需要能够在数据生成的瞬间进行处理和分析。数据湖能够以较低的成本存储和处理这些实时数据,帮助企业实时洞察市场动态和客户行为。这种能力对于希望快速响应市场变化的企业来说至关重要。
三、数据湖在数据整合与分析中的效率提升
数据湖通过集中存储来自不同来源的数据,显著提升了数据整合的效率。传统的数据管理方式往往导致数据孤岛现象,不同部门或系统之间的数据无法共享,导致重复工作和低效的问题。而数据湖的出现,打破了这种数据壁垒,使得企业可以在一个平台上访问和分析所有数据。这种整合能力不仅节省了时间和资源,还提高了数据分析的准确性和全面性。
在分析层面,数据湖支持多种分析工具和技术的无缝集成。数据科学家可以使用机器学习、数据挖掘等技术对数据进行深入分析,从而发现潜在的商业价值。数据湖还允许分析师使用多种编程语言和工具进行数据处理,这种灵活性使得企业能够根据项目需要选择最合适的技术和工具,进一步提高了分析效率。
四、大规模数据处理的成本效益
随着数据量的不断增加,企业面临着高昂的数据存储和处理成本。传统的数据库往往需要昂贵的硬件和软件支持,而数据湖的分布式存储架构则大大降低了这方面的开支。通过使用开放源代码的技术和云计算资源,企业可以以更低的成本实现大规模数据的存储和处理。
此外,数据湖的架构使得企业能够根据需要进行资源的动态扩展。在数据需求增加时,企业可以轻松地扩展存储和计算能力,而无需进行复杂的系统升级。这种弹性能力不仅降低了基础设施的维护成本,还提高了资源的使用效率。
五、数据湖与数据仓库的比较
在了解数据湖的优势之前,了解数据湖与传统数据仓库的区别是非常重要的。数据仓库通常采用高度结构化的数据存储方式,这使得数据在存储之前必须经过严格的清洗和转换。而数据湖则允许企业以原始格式存储数据,后续再进行处理。这种灵活性使得数据湖能够更好地应对快速变化的数据需求。
数据仓库通常更适合用于历史数据分析和业务报表,而数据湖则更适合用于大数据分析和机器学习等复杂应用。数据仓库在数据分析速度上具有优势,但数据湖在处理多样性和灵活性上表现更加出色。因此,许多企业开始同时使用数据湖和数据仓库,以便在不同场景下发挥各自的优势。
六、数据湖的挑战与解决方案
尽管数据湖具有许多优势,但在实际应用中也面临一些挑战。首先,数据质量管理是一个重要问题。由于数据湖中存储了大量原始数据,可能包含重复、错误或不一致的数据。因此,企业需要建立有效的数据治理机制,以确保数据的质量和可靠性。
其次,数据安全与隐私保护也是数据湖面临的挑战。随着数据泄露事件频发,企业需要采取强有力的安全措施,保护存储在数据湖中的敏感信息。这可以通过加密、访问控制和监控等手段来实现。
最后,技术选择与架构设计也是企业在构建数据湖时需要考虑的因素。企业需要根据自身的需求与资源,选择合适的存储与处理技术,以确保数据湖的高效运作。通过合理的架构设计,企业可以实现数据湖的最佳性能,并最大限度地发挥其潜力。
七、数据湖的未来发展趋势
数据湖的未来发展趋势主要体现在以下几个方面。首先,随着人工智能和机器学习的不断发展,数据湖将越来越多地与这些技术结合,实现更深层次的数据分析和挖掘。企业将能够利用数据湖中的海量数据,训练更为精准的模型,从而提升业务决策的科学性。
其次,数据湖的自动化管理将成为趋势。通过引入自动化工具与技术,企业可以减少人工干预,提高数据处理和管理的效率。这将使得数据湖的运作更加高效,降低管理成本。
最后,随着数据隐私法规的日益严格,数据湖在合规性方面的要求也将不断提高。企业需要在构建数据湖时,充分考虑合规性问题,确保数据的合法使用与存储。通过建立完善的数据治理框架,企业可以更好地应对合规性挑战,维护品牌声誉。
数据湖作为一种新兴的数据管理解决方案,正在为企业提供更多的机遇与挑战。通过有效利用数据湖,企业能够在激烈的市场竞争中占据优势,实现更快速的创新与增长。
1年前 -
数据湖解决了数据存储的灵活性、数据处理的高效性、数据分析的全面性等问题。首先,数据湖为企业提供了一个可以存储各种格式数据的集中式平台,包括结构化、半结构化和非结构化数据,这使得企业可以更灵活地管理数据。传统的数据仓库通常需要事先定义数据结构,而数据湖则允许企业在数据生成后再进行处理和分析。以数据处理的高效性为例,数据湖利用分布式计算框架,可以在大规模数据集上快速执行复杂的查询和分析任务,从而大幅提高数据处理效率。
一、数据湖的定义与概念
数据湖是一个集中式的存储库,用于保存大量的原始数据,这些数据可以是结构化的、半结构化的或非结构化的。与传统的数据仓库不同,数据湖不要求在数据存储之前进行严格的模式定义。数据湖的设计理念是“存储一切”,这意味着企业可以在数据生成的任何阶段将其存储在数据湖中,无论是日志文件、社交媒体数据、传感器数据还是数据库记录。数据湖的出现是为了应对大数据时代带来的数据多样性和复杂性。
二、数据湖解决的数据存储灵活性问题
在传统的数据管理系统中,数据存储通常依赖于预定义的模式,这一过程往往耗时耗力,并限制了数据的使用灵活性。数据湖的灵活性体现在多个方面。首先,数据湖允许企业存储各种格式的数据,这使得企业能够处理来自不同来源的数据。比如,企业可以将客户的社交媒体评论、网站日志、交易记录等多种数据类型汇集到一个地方,进行统一管理。其次,数据湖支持实时数据流的接入,企业可以实时收集和分析数据,从而更快地做出决策。最后,数据湖的存储成本相对较低,企业可以以更经济的方式存储大量数据,而不必担心传统存储解决方案中的高昂费用。
三、数据湖的高效数据处理能力
数据湖的设计理念不仅仅是存储,更重要的是如何高效地处理这些数据。数据湖通常与现代的分布式计算框架相结合,如Apache Hadoop、Apache Spark等,这使得企业能够在大规模数据集上进行快速的分析和处理。通过并行计算,数据湖能够在数分钟内完成传统数据仓库需要数小时才能完成的任务。此外,数据湖支持多种数据处理方式,包括批处理和流处理,企业可以根据需求选择适合的处理模式。
企业在使用数据湖进行数据处理时,通常会遵循以下流程:
- 数据采集:将来自不同来源的数据传输到数据湖中,这个过程可以是实时或定期的。
- 数据存储:数据以原始格式存储在数据湖中,无需预先定义数据结构。
- 数据处理:使用分布式计算框架对数据进行清洗、转换和分析,能够处理海量数据。
- 数据分析:分析师可以使用各种工具和技术对数据进行深入分析,生成报告和可视化结果。
四、数据湖在数据分析中的全面性
数据湖不仅仅是一个数据存储平台,更是一个强大的分析工具。由于数据湖存储了来自不同来源和格式的大量数据,分析师可以进行全面的数据分析,从而获得更深入的洞察。例如,企业可以结合客户的交易数据和社交媒体评论进行情感分析,以了解消费者对产品的看法。这种全面性使得企业能够在竞争激烈的市场中保持优势。
此外,数据湖还支持机器学习和人工智能的应用。企业可以利用数据湖中存储的大量历史数据训练机器学习模型,从而提高预测精度和决策质量。通过将数据湖与机器学习框架(如TensorFlow、PyTorch等)结合,企业可以实现更智能的数据分析和决策支持。
五、数据湖的挑战与应对策略
尽管数据湖具有许多优点,但在实际应用中也面临一些挑战。首先,数据湖中的数据质量问题不容忽视。由于数据是以原始格式存储,数据的完整性和一致性可能受到影响。为了应对这一挑战,企业需要建立严格的数据治理政策,确保在数据进入数据湖之前进行必要的清洗和验证。
其次,数据湖的安全性也是一个重要问题。企业需要确保敏感数据的保护,防止未经授权的访问。为此,企业可以采取数据加密、访问控制和审计机制等安全措施,确保数据的安全性。
最后,数据湖的管理和维护也是一项重要的任务。随着数据量的不断增长,企业需要定期对数据湖进行监控和优化,以确保其性能和可用性。企业可以使用自动化工具和技术,对数据湖进行监控和维护,提高管理效率。
六、数据湖的未来发展趋势
随着大数据技术的不断演进,数据湖的未来发展趋势也将面临新的机遇和挑战。首先,数据湖将越来越多地与云计算相结合,企业可以利用云服务提供商的弹性计算和存储能力,降低基础设施成本。其次,随着人工智能和机器学习技术的不断发展,数据湖将成为企业实现智能决策的重要基础。企业可以利用数据湖中的大量数据来训练和优化机器学习模型,提高预测准确性。
此外,数据湖的治理和安全性将会变得更加重要。随着数据隐私法规的日益严格,企业需要加强对数据的管理和保护,以确保合规性和数据安全。为了满足这些需求,数据湖将需要集成更强大的数据治理和安全工具,确保数据的完整性和保密性。
在未来,数据湖将继续发挥其在数据存储和分析中的重要作用,帮助企业应对数据挑战,实现智能化决策和业务创新。
1年前


